怎么把一个svn项目传到github
-
将一个已经存在于SVN的项目迁移到GitHub可以按照以下步骤进行:
Step 1: 创建新的GitHub仓库
首先,登录到GitHub上并创建一个新的仓库。在创建过程中,你可以选择公开或私有的仓库,以及添加仓库描述等其他设置。Step 2: 安装并配置Git
在本地计算机上安装Git,并配置好自己的用户名和邮箱地址。可以使用以下命令进行配置:“`
$ git config –global user.name “Your Name”
$ git config –global user.email “youremail@example.com”
“`Step 3: 克隆GitHub仓库到本地
在本地选择一个合适的位置,打开命令行并执行以下命令,将GitHub仓库克隆到本地:“`
$ git clone
“`Step 4: 导出SVN项目
使用SVN客户端导出项目的最新版本,保存到本地的一个临时目录中。Step 5: 将导出的项目复制到GitHub仓库中
将导出的项目复制到刚刚克隆的GitHub仓库的文件夹中。Step 6: 添加文件到暂存区
执行以下命令将项目文件添加到Git的暂存区:“`
$ git add .
“`Step 7: 提交到本地仓库
执行以下命令将文件提交到本地仓库:“`
$ git commit -m “Initial commit”
“`Step 8: 将本地仓库与远程GitHub仓库关联
执行以下命令将本地仓库与远程GitHub仓库进行关联:“`
$ git remote add origin
“`Step 9: 推送到GitHub仓库
执行以下命令将本地仓库的内容推送到GitHub仓库:“`
$ git push origin master
“`Step 10: 完成
现在,你的SVN项目已经成功传到GitHub仓库了。需要注意的是,迁移过程中可能会遇到一些冲突或者其他问题,需要根据具体情况来解决。另外,在迁移之前最好备份好原始的SVN项目,以防万一出现问题。
2年前 -
将一个 SVN 项目传到 GitHub 需要以下步骤:
1. 在 GitHub 上创建一个新的仓库
登录 GitHub,并点击页面右上角的 “+” 图标,选择 “New Repository”。填写仓库的名称、描述和其他相关信息,然后点击 “Create Repository”。2. 安装 Git 工具
如果你还没有安装 Git 工具,需要先安装 Git。Git 是一个版本控制工具,可以帮助进行代码管理和提交。3. 克隆 SVN 项目到本地
使用 SVN 工具将项目克隆到本地。在命令行中运行以下命令:
“`
svn co
“`
其中,是 SVN 项目的 URL 地址, 是本地文件夹的路径。 4. 创建一个新的 Git 仓库
在本地项目文件夹中,运行以下命令来初始化一个新的 Git 仓库:
“`
git init
“`5. 添加所有文件到 Git 仓库
运行以下命令将项目中的所有文件添加到 Git 仓库中:
“`
git add .
“`6. 提交文件到 Git 仓库
运行以下命令将文件提交到 Git 仓库:
“`
git commit -m “Initial commit”
“`7. 将本地仓库关联到 GitHub 远程仓库
运行以下命令将本地仓库关联到 GitHub 远程仓库:
“`
git remote add origin
“`
其中,是 GitHub 仓库的 URL 地址。 8. 推送本地仓库到 GitHub 远程仓库
运行以下命令将本地仓库推送到 GitHub 远程仓库:
“`
git push -u origin master
“`完成上述步骤后,你的 SVN 项目就已成功传到 GitHub 仓库中了。你可以通过访问 GitHub 仓库页面来查看代码和进行其他操作。记住,GitHub 是一个分布式版本控制平台,提交和管理代码的工作流程与 SVN 有所不同。你可以使用 Git 提供的强大功能来管理你的项目。
2年前 -
将一个SVN项目传到GitHub需要经过以下步骤:
1. 创建一个新的GitHub仓库
首先,打开GitHub的网站,登录您的帐户。然后,单击右上角的”+ New repository”按钮,命名您的仓库并设置相关参数(如描述、公开/私有等)。2. 初始化本地项目
在本地计算机上,找到并进入您的SVN项目的根目录。使用命令行或终端,运行`git init`命令初始化该目录为Git仓库。3. 将SVN项目导出到本地
使用SVN客户端,在本地创建一个新的目录,用于导出SVN项目的最新版本。然后,运行SVN导出命令,如`svn export svn://svnserver/project/path`,将项目导出到新目录中。4. 将导出的文件复制到Git仓库目录
将步骤3中导出的文件复制到Git仓库的目录中。确保所有SVN文件和目录都复制到正确的位置。5. 添加、提交和推送
在Git仓库目录中,使用命令行或终端运行以下命令:
“`
git add .
git commit -m “Initial commit”
git remote add origin [GitHub仓库的URL]
git push -u origin master
“`
这将把所有文件添加到Git的暂存区,创建一个初始提交并将其推送到GitHub。6. 同步更新
如果您之后想要将SVN项目的更改同步到GitHub,可以在SVN项目目录中运行`git pull`命令,然后再次使用`git push`命令将更改推送到GitHub。通过以上步骤,您就可以将一个SVN项目成功传到GitHub上了。请注意,这只是简化的概述,具体步骤可能会因项目的复杂性和个人偏好而有所不同。如果您在其中的任何步骤中遇到问题,可以参考Git和SVN的官方文档或寻求相关的在线资源和帮助。
2年前